Summary:
This book offers the first panoramic study on the development and characteristics of the literary-journalistic genre of spectator periodicals in Hispanic America and Brazil. After contextualizing these publications within the emancipation processes of 19th-century American Enlightenment, it explores the new coexistence modes and esthetics they disseminated.
